The analysis of expected thermal behaviour of MOA on a 110 kV overhead line focusing in particular the risk of thermal runaway

摘要

The paper deals with some important aspects to beconsidered while installing metal-oxide arresters(MOA) on high voltage overhead transmission lines. Itgives an insight into some Slovene experiences gainedin the past decade, and assesses the expected long termbehaviour of metal-oxide resistor blocks based onaccellerated ageing test results. Thermal behaviour ofMOA analysed by means of a simplified thermal modelis shown for some combined stresses. Also, the paperdescribes the procedure while optimizing theovervoltage protection by installing MOA on a 110 kVtransmission line in Slovenia.
